IMAGE Winter is out now! Find out what’s inside…

IMAGE Winter is out now! Find out what’s inside…


by Lauren Heskin
10th Nov 2023

IMAGE Winter hits shelves tomorrow, November 11. Editor Lauren Heskin introduces the issue and gives a sneak peek of what’s inside...

There is something about winter that really draws you in. Of course, we all lament the dark evenings and mornings, the soggy trudge along rain-soaked streets. But even so, there’s something… magical about it.

Swirls of chimney smoke rising in the air; the peek you get in living room windows at dusk, before inhabitants remember to draw the curtains; the noisy clack of a taxi of revellers spilling onto the path, giggling as they duck into a doorway.

Capturing the season’s aura is Michelle Hanley, as she speaks to tincture makers, astrologists and incense creators about witchy winter rituals.

Speaking of auras, Jan Brierton does her darndest to capture the magic of Sinéad O’Connor’s in a personal essay.

Winter is a time to gather round and we pull up a seat at the table of zero-waste chef Orla McAndrew as she gives festive leftovers a new life; then it’s time to nestle into a good book, courtesy of Jennifer McShane’s top picks.

Pearl Reddington welcomes us to her home in Leitrim, where she is bringing the term “cottage industry” into the modern era with her beautiful knitted creations.

Ruth O’Connor hails the return of the rich, russet hues of corduroy as it sweeps fashion catwalks and the high street alike.

There is a magpie-like tendency to this time of year too, from gifting to glamour. Melanie Morris decides that we should all be self-gifting this year and selects her own beauty wishlist, while Sinéad Keenan reflects on her favourite metallic touches from the catwalks.

Elsewhere, there’s plenty of shine to be found in jewellery designer Chupi Sweetman’s home, where her glittering talents are splashed across walls and stairways.

Of course, with the darkness also brings a sense of longing – to go out, to get away. From quick staycation trips to Cork, Clare and Dublin, and Sarah Gill’s pal-finding guide to get you out of your comfort zone, to photographer Emilija Jefremova’s hike of Kilimanjaro,  as Lizzie Gore-Grimes skis right to the door of a year-round Austrian retreat.

Whether you’re yearning to stay in or get out and about this season, I hope you find something within the pages to catch your eye.
